Lead SQL Server Developer

Sé de los primeros solicitantes.
PSC Industries
Ciudad de México
MXN 200,000 - 400,000
Sé de los primeros solicitantes.
Hace 4 días
Descripción del empleo

Job Description:

We are seeking an experienced SQL Server Database Developer to join our team at Lead Allies Inc. As a key member of our database team, you will play a crucial role in designing, developing, and optimizing SQL Server databases to ensure the highest level of performance, reliability, and scalability for our applications.

Responsibilities:

  1. Database Development: Design, develop, and implement complex SQL queries, stored procedures, functions, and triggers for various business applications.
  2. Performance Tuning & Optimization: Identify and resolve performance bottlenecks using advanced techniques, including index optimization, query tuning, execution plan analysis, and optimization of database configurations.
  3. Troubleshooting & Debugging: Troubleshoot and resolve performance issues and errors within SQL Server environments, applying in-depth knowledge of SQL Server internals to quickly identify root causes and implement effective solutions.
  4. Database Architecture & Design: Assist in the architectural design and implementation of high-performing SQL Server databases to meet both current and future business requirements.
  5. High Availability & Scalability: Design, configure, and maintain high-availability solutions such as Always On Availability Groups, clustering, replication, and other disaster recovery techniques to ensure database uptime.
  6. Database Monitoring: Use SQL Server Management Studio (SSMS) and third-party monitoring tools to proactively monitor database performance and make recommendations for improvement.
  7. Security & Compliance: Implement database security measures, ensuring that sensitive data is protected and compliant with regulatory requirements (e.g., GDPR, HIPAA).
  8. Documentation: Maintain thorough documentation of database configurations, changes, performance improvements, and optimization procedures.
  9. Collaboration: Work closely with cross-functional teams (application developers, system administrators, etc.) to ensure the smooth operation of database systems.
  10. Stay Current with SQL Server Updates: Continuously evaluate and apply new SQL Server features and best practices, keeping the database systems aligned with industry standards.
  11. Cloud SQL Management: Design, implement, and maintain SQL Server databases on cloud platforms such as Microsoft Azure SQL Database, Amazon RDS for SQL Server, or Google Cloud SQL, ensuring high availability, scalability, and security.
  12. Cloud Integration: Work with cloud providers and integration tools to ensure seamless interaction between cloud-based databases and other cloud services.

Required Skills & Qualifications:

  1. Experience: 5+ years of experience working with SQL Server database development, with a focus on performance tuning, query optimization, and troubleshooting.
  2. SQL Server Expertise: Deep technical knowledge of SQL Server (2016 or later) architecture, internals, and background processes such as transaction logs, locking, and resource management.
  3. Performance Tuning: Proven track record in identifying performance bottlenecks and resolving issues related to query performance, indexing, and database configuration.
  4. Indexing & Query Optimization: Advanced knowledge of indexing strategies (clustered, non-clustered, filtered, and full text), and ability to optimize complex SQL queries.
  5. High Availability & Disaster Recovery: In-depth knowledge of SQL Server high availability technologies such as Always On Availability Groups, database mirroring, replication, and log shipping.
  6. Tools: Proficient in using SQL Server Management Studio (SSMS), SQL Profiler, and other performance monitoring tools (e.g., Redgate, SolarWinds, etc.).
  7. Scripting: Strong ability to write and automate T-SQL scripts and working knowledge of PowerShell or other scripting languages for database management tasks.
  8. Problem-Solving Skills: Strong analytical and problem-solving abilities, particularly in high-pressure environments.
  9. Communication: Excellent communication skills to effectively collaborate with developers, system administrators, and business stakeholders.
  10. Certifications: Microsoft Certified: Azure Data Engineer, Microsoft Certified: SQL Server (or similar) certifications are a plus.

Others:

  1. Must be authorized to work in the United States
  2. Background check required
  3. Willingness to travel up to 10% of the time
Obtenga la revisión gratuita y confidencial de su currículum.
Selecciona un archivo o arrástralo y suéltalo
Avatar
Asesoramiento online gratuito
¡Mejora tus posibilidades de entrevistarte para ese puesto!
Adelántate y explora vacantes nuevas de Lead SQL Server Developer en